Reflex arc refers to the neuronal pathway which is activated during the reflex or emergency actions in the body.
The reflex arc pathway is a very fast response as it shortens the time of the neuronal pathway.
When the receptor senses the reflex stimuli, it immediately generates the signals and transmits them to the spinal cord through the afferent or sensory neuron. When the signal reaches the spinal cord then the signals are perceived by the interneurons or control centre of the spinal cord and then transmit the response to the effector muscle through the efferent neuron or the motor neuron. This whole pathway is followed in just a few milliseconds.
